Eileen A. O’Reilly, age 87, was born in Columbus July 27, 1936, was called to the Lord January 17, 2024. She was preceded in death by her parents, Joseph and Margaret O’Reilly; brothers Joseph, Robert and David; sisters Helen Murrin and Mary Catherine Hawkins. Survived by sister-in-law Susie O’Reilly, many nieces, nephews, great nieces and great nephews.
Eileen attended Old St. Peter Parish School and graduated from Holy family High School. At age 18 she began work at Ohio Bell and stayed until retirement from AT&T.
Eileen was a long time member Our Lady of Peace Parish, The Holy family Alumni and the AT&T Pioneers. Eileen loved being with family, attending all family celebrations and gatherings, especially St. Patrick’s Day festivities.
Eileen’s family would like to thank all those who cared for her during her extended illness; The Blue Girls at Dublin Retirement Village; the caregivers and staff at The Avalon of Lewis Center; the nurses and staff from Capital City Hospice.
